UNION COMPANY’S LINE
The JKahiia is. loading timber at Greymouth. for Melbourne sailing ’today. ' ' { . J; The JCaimai leaves Wellington today and is d'.ie at Greymouth ( to-mo:-row njght to load coal for the same port. The Kiwitea is loading coal at Greymouth for Wellington sailing tc-clay. The Kartigi arrived at Greymou h. yesterday from Auckand to load 't'riiber for Sydney. The Totara is.due at Greymouth tomorrow from New Plymouth to lea I coal for the same port. i SHIPPING TELEGRAMS. GREYMOUTH, July 20. Sailed 3 p.m. Titoki, 1 for Tarakohe. v Sailed 12.10< a.m. Huanui, for Foxton . Arrived;- 1P.20- p.m. Yesterday, To? tara from New Plymouth.
